UNTERLANGENEGG
Canton : Bern
German | Geviert von Schwarz mit einer halben silbernen Burg am Spalt, und von Silber mit einer ausgerissenen grünen Tanne mit rotem Stamm. |
English | No blazon/translation known. Please click here to send your (heraldic !) blazon or translation |
Origin/meaning
The black quarters are canting for the Schwarzenegg village, the trees are a symbol for the forests in the area. The castle is taken from the arms of Steffisburg, to which the village belonged hiostorically.
Literature: Wappenbuch des Kantons Bern, 1981.
